In the parallelogram \(OABC\), \(\vec{OA} = \mathbf{a}\) and \(\vec{OC} = \mathbf{c}\). The point \(M\) is the midpoint of the side \(BC\) and the point \(N\) lies on the diagonal \(AC\) such that \(AN:NC = 2:1\).
(a) Express \(\vec{AC}\) and \(\vec{OM}\) in terms of \(\mathbf{a}\) and \(\mathbf{c}\).
(b) Show that \(\vec{ON} = \frac{1}{3}\mathbf{a} + \frac{2}{3}\mathbf{c}\).
(c) Use your answers to parts (a) and (b) to show that the points \(O, N,\) and \(M\) are collinear and find the ratio \(ON:OM\).
